Как размонтировать недоступную шару NFS с открытыми файлами.

Существует общий ресурс NFS, смонтированный в /media/nfs.

$ mount -t nfs4
192.168.88.106:/mnt/disk on /media/nfs type nfs4 (rw,relatime,vers=4.2,rsize=131072,wsize=131072,namlen=255,hard,proto=tcp,timeo=600,retrans=2,sec=sys,clientaddr=10.0.2.15,local_lock=none,addr=192.168.88.106)

Он не может быть размонтирован.

$ sudo umount /media/nfs 
umount.nfs4: /media/nfs: device is busy
Использование force также не помогает.
$ sudo umount --force /media/nfs 
umount.nfs4: /media/nfs: device is busy

Решение состоит в том, чтобы использовать lazy!

$ sudo umount --lazy /media/nfs

Общий ресурс NFS был отделен от файловой иерархии, и все ссылки на него будут очищены, как только он больше не будет занят.

$ mount -t nfs4
$
Это только для экстренного использования.
Поделитесь статьей:

Добавить комментарий